#055bb0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#055bb0 is composed of 2% red, 35.7%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 209.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 35.5%. #055bb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ab6ff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#055bb0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#055bb0 has RGB values of R:5, G:91,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 351152.

Hex triplet 055bb0 #055bb0
RGB Decimal 5, 91, 176 rgb(5,91,176)
RGB Percent 2, 35.7, 69 rgb(2%,35.7%,69%)
CMYK 97, 48, 0, 31
HSL 209.8°, 94.5, 35.5 hsl(209.8,94.5%,35.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 209.8°, 97.2, 69
Web Safe 006699 #006699
CIE-LAB 38.981, 11.3, -51.384
XYZ 11.638, 10.648, 42.514
xyY 0.18, 0.164, 10.648
CIE-LCH 38.981, 52.612, 282.402
CIE-LUV 38.981, -21.329, -74.858
Hunter-Lab 32.631, 6.56, -54.404
Binary 00000101, 01011011, 10110000

Shades and Tints of #055bb0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#055bb0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595b5c is the less saturated color, while #055bb0 is the most saturated one.
